微波EDA网,见证研发工程师的成长!
首页 > 研发问答 > 嵌入式设计讨论 > MCU和单片机设计讨论 > 工程测试之GPIO(AC6)

工程测试之GPIO(AC6)

时间:10-02 整理:3721RD 点击:

由于ST目前主推的是HAL库,而HAL库可以使用STM32CubeMX新建、部署工程、外设等等,那么使用STM32CubeMX来测试就再方便不过了。

GPIO的测试,首先最简单的就是LED灯的控制 了,在开发板的底板上有两个LED灯。





这两个LED接在了PB0与PB1两个引脚上。




我们使用STM32CubeMX将PB0与PB1设置为GPIO_Output模式。



并生成AC6的工程与代码,使用AC6打开工程,并编译,可以看到,工程编译一次使用的时间,这与电脑配置、软件设置等等因素有关,不过还是很快的。




配置好仿真工具后,点击Debug进行仿真界面,点击Run后,可以看到,开发板底板上的DS1闪烁了。




最后来看一下工程结构。Drivers中的是架构相关与HAL库文件,这里的文件一般是不要进行更改的。Src与Inc是生成的外设配置文件与main文件。一般若是编程分层明确时,这几个文件最好也是不要更改的,新建自己的应用层文件。





Copyright © 2017-2020 微波EDA网 版权所有

网站地图

Top